Nintendo has released a new Wii U advert for Mass Effect 3 Special Edition.

BioWare's first ever title on a Nintendo home console offers a new control scheme designed to incorporate the Wii U GamePad. Features include the ability to position squad mates and utilise their abilities with the tablet controller.

Running at 720p, the Special Edition also features bonus DLC including the Extended Cut and an interactive back story covering previous events in the Mass Effect universe.

However, publisher EA said this week that the upcoming Omega DLC will not be released for Nintendo's new console.
